大数跨境

进阶OpenClaw(龙虾)服务器运维FAQ汇总

2026-03-19 2
详情
报告
跨境服务
文章

引言

进阶OpenClaw(龙虾)服务器运维FAQ汇总 是面向使用 OpenClaw(业内俗称“龙虾”)开源自动化运维框架的跨境卖家技术团队或独立站/ERP自建系统运维人员整理的实操型问题集。OpenClaw 是一套基于 Python + Ansible + Flask 构建的轻量级服务器集群管理工具,非商业SaaS产品,常用于部署和监控独立站、爬虫节点、数据同步服务等跨境基础设施。

 

主体

它能解决哪些问题

  • 场景痛点:多台海外云服务器(如 AWS EC2、DigitalOcean Droplet)手动更新 SSL 证书频繁超时 → 对应价值:通过内置 Certbot 自动轮转与健康检查,降低 HTTPS 中断风险
  • 场景痛点:新上线站点需批量部署 Nginx + Redis + PostgreSQL 环境,每次重装耗时 2+ 小时 → 对应价值:预置 Playbook 模板支持一键初始化 LEMP/LAMP 栈,平均部署时间压缩至 8 分钟内
  • 场景痛点:监控告警依赖第三方(如 UptimeRobot),无法关联日志与进程状态 → 对应价值:集成 Prometheus + Grafana + 自研日志解析模块,可按关键词(如 '502 Bad Gateway'、'Connection refused')触发钉钉/企业微信告警

怎么用/怎么开通/怎么选择

OpenClaw 为开源项目(GitHub 仓库:openclaw/openclaw),无官方注册/购买流程,需自行部署:

  1. 确认目标服务器已安装 Python 3.9+、Git、Ansible 2.12+;
  2. 克隆主仓库:git clone https://github.com/openclaw/openclaw.git
  3. 修改 inventory/production.yml 填入目标服务器 IP、SSH 用户及密钥路径;
  4. 根据需求启用模块(如 nginxcertbotprometheus),在 group_vars/all.yml 中配置参数;
  5. 执行部署命令:ansible-playbook site.yml -i inventory/production.yml --limit=web_servers
  6. 访问 Web 控制台(默认监听 5000 端口,需自行配置反向代理与 Basic Auth)。

注:无官方托管服务;若使用第三方封装版(如某服务商提供的“龙虾Pro托管版”),其开通流程、权限模型、API 接口均以该服务商文档为准。

费用/成本通常受哪些因素影响

  • 所选云厂商实例规格(CPU/内存/带宽)及地域(如美西 vs 新加坡节点价格差异显著);
  • 是否启用高可用架构(如双机热备、跨AZ部署)导致资源冗余成本上升;
  • 自定义模块开发工作量(如对接 Shopify Webhook 日志归集、WooCommerce 订单同步插件);
  • 安全加固投入(如 TOTP 双因子登录、审计日志留存周期合规要求);
  • 团队运维能力水平(初级工程师需额外配置调试时间,影响隐性人力成本)。

为了拿到准确部署与维护成本,你通常需要准备:目标服务器数量及分布区域、预期并发请求量(QPS)、SLA 要求(如 99.9% uptime)、现有技术栈兼容性清单(如是否已用 Terraform 管理 IaC)

常见坑与避坑清单

  • 避坑1:直接在生产环境运行 site.yml 全量重装 → 建议先用 --check 参数做模拟执行,再对核心服务(如数据库)单独执行 tags 部署
  • 避坑2:忽略 SSH 密钥权限设置(如私钥 chmod 600 缺失)→ 导致 Ansible 连接失败且报错模糊,应在 ansible.cfg 中启用 host_key_checking = False 并验证密钥有效性
  • 避坑3:Grafana 面板未导出备份 → 一旦容器重建即丢失可视化配置,建议定期执行 grafana-cli admin export-dashboards 并纳入 Git 版本控制
  • 避坑4:Certbot 自动续期失败后无兜底通知 → 必须在 crontab 中添加失败日志检测脚本,并绑定企业 IM 告警通道

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 本身是 MIT 协议开源项目,代码公开可审计,无后门或数据回传机制;但其合规性取决于使用者部署方式——例如在欧盟服务器运行需自行确保 GDPR 日志脱敏、SSL 证书符合 eIDAS 标准;不提供 ISO 27001 或 SOC2 认证,亦非支付卡行业(PCI DSS)合规方案,不可用于直连信用卡交易系统。

{关键词} 适合哪些卖家/平台/地区/类目?

适合具备基础 Linux 运维能力的中大型跨境卖家(年 GMV ≥ $5M)、自建站团队或 ERP 开发方;典型适用场景包括:独立站(Shopify Headless / WooCommerce)、多平台数据聚合中台(对接 Amazon SP API、TikTok Shop Seller Center)、爬虫调度节点(比价/舆情监控);对服务器延迟敏感的类目(如直播带货后台、实时库存同步)需优先选择与业务目标市场同地域部署(如面向巴西消费者则选 SA-East-1 区)。

{关键词} 常见失败原因是什么?如何排查?

高频失败原因:① Ansible 控制端 Python 环境缺失 pywinrm(Windows 目标机场景)或 openssh-client(Ubuntu 22.04+ 默认未预装);② inventory 文件中主机名解析失败(未配置 /etc/hosts 或 DNS 不可达);③ Playbook 中 become: yes 权限提升失败(目标机 sudoers 未授权 NOPASSWD)。排查建议:执行 ansible -m ping all -i inventory/production.yml -vvv 查看连接级详细日志。

结尾

进阶OpenClaw(龙虾)服务器运维FAQ汇总聚焦真实部署问题,不替代官方文档,所有操作请以 GitHub 主仓库 README 与各模块 CHANGELOG 为准。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业